Abstract In this paper, a modular charging design that uses the sunlight as input power to charge the golf carts used in the United Arab Emirates University (UAEU) campus is presented. The design of the charging station involves several steps such determining the required power level in order to meet the load requirement, optimizing the charger design, and most importantly, evaluating the economic feasibility of the charging station. An overview of the project is presented followed by design considerations and evaluation of the system size and economic feasibility.
